Realme 7 Pro Realme UI 2.0 Beta 4 update adds Starry Mode and several fixes

Realme is now rolling out software version RMX2170_11_C.14 to eligible Realme 7 Pro handsets in India. The fourth Android 11 beta update weighs in at 445MB.

The official changelog contains an extensive list of bugs that have been fixed in this update. It also mentions that the excessive Camera features such as Ultra Night, 64MP, 4K 30FPS recording, and some bug has been fixed as well. Additionally, the update fixes some mobile features – Settings, App, Call, Notification, and more.

Realme 7 Pro Realme UI 2.0 Beta 4 Changelog

  • Camera
    • Added Starry mode
    • Fixed the issue that the video cannot be saved after the video is successfully shot in Ultra Night
    • Fixed the issue of line display problem in the imaged picture when taking pictures in 64M mode
    • Fixed the issue of Night Scene Pro, when adjusting the S value to a large value, the home button exits during the shooting process, and the preview freezes and crashes when entering the camera again
    • Fixed the camera 4K30 frame, switch video encoding, shoot video, check the thumbnail and return to the camera, the camera crashes
  • Call
    • Fixed the issue that VoLTE shuts down after the headset is plugged in after selecting the “TTY full” menu in the accessibility features of the call settings
  • Apps
    • Optimized the display logic of backlight brightness after some apps are started
  • Settings
    • Fixed the issue of probabilistic failure of vibration feedback during keyboard input
    • Fixed the issue that when a locked SIM card is inserted, the password input interface pops up, and the desktop can be seen transparently
    • Fixed the App lock page, click back, the page flashes back
  • Lockscreen
    • Fixed the issue that the time is not displayed in the status bar when sliding up the lock screen interface and switching to the password interface
  • Notification
    • Fixed the issue of extra characters displayed in the notification panel traffic usage

If you participate in the Realme UI 2.0 beta program and you own the Realme 7 Pro in India then you should be able to download the latest beta firmware by opening Settings on your phone, accessing Software update, and tapping Download and install.
